Abstract


Speed setting plays an important role in the direct current motor, because the motor has a direct current coupling characteristic speed profitable compared to other motors. From both of these characteristics can be used as a basis to set the dc shunt motor speed. If a decline in motor speed due to the increase in load current (Ia), the field current (If) is set (reduced) so that the motor speed be maintained at the desired rotation. In the design of the most important stages of this research. In the design phase to understand the properties, characteristics, specifications of components used and the steps that must be considered by using the block diagram of DC motor supply circuit blocks, smart relay circuit blocks, block string of resistors, and a DC motor circuit blocks, each this circuit has the function block and work differently but interrelated. Based on data and analysis can then be seen that the larger the anchor resistance will decrease the speed of the motor to hold the armature and the greater the speed the greater the resistance to hold field.
